i was wondering if there was a program that i can use to prevent people from installing **** on my computer? Something that will make you enter a password in order to install any program. This is for my computer at work. I cannot have a personal account or login password,company policy, i keep having people at work installing stupid things.

Go to Control Panel -> User Accounts -> Create a new account, Limited Account.

Then, password protect your Admin account.
 
thats exactly what i CANNOT have...is there anything to prevent just ANYONE from installing stuff on my windows....without needing to setup an admin account
 
Just disable the Windows Installer service :) Then when YOU need to install something simply go into the services MMC and re-enable it..anyone with advanced pc skills can figure this out and re-enable it themselves..but usually in offices they arent that savy ;)
